The ancestral avenger is a uniquely elven prestige class. Long ago, the elven race was split by terrible racial wars. Whole legions of dark-hearted elves turned toward the worship of Lolth and eventually fled underground. The remaining surface elves never forgot the betrayal and depravity of these twisted brethren. Never.

Among the ranks of the elves, a secret few are trained to focus on the destruction of dark elves. These elves hate drow more than anything else, and their training allows them to become the most efficient and deadly foes the dark elves have ever faced. They are trained to resist drow spells and overcome whatever defenses and allies the drow possess.

Ancestral avengers are found among all classes. However, many elven rangers who have taken Humanoid (drow) as a racial enemy (one of the only instances in which a good-aligned character can take his own race as a racial enemy), are often drawn to this path.
